Reviews of 49007 Kalamazoo, MI are overwhelmingly positive with many people touting how friendly the locals are and what there is to do in the area. Kalamazoo is known for its wealth of out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and camping. The city is also home to a wide variety of museums, art galleries, and cultural centers. In addition, Kalamazoo hosts several annual festivals that celebrate its diverse culture in an exciting way. Visitors come from near and far to experience the city’s renowned craft breweries and local restaurants. With its vibrant nightlife and plenty of shopping options, it’s easy to see why so many rave about this Michigan destination!

North Side of Kalamazoo - 1/4/2010
As a life long resident I feel that the North Side has changed. Although it is the oldest part of the City Of Kalamazoo it has the most to gain. The homes average 100 years old. There are plots built in the 1950's that are a bargain in todays market. The North Side is a baby boomer's dream only 10 minuets away from downtown. Why buy downtown with no green grass or trees, when you can get a home and a lot with moderate taxes.
